Create menu-based programs using guis

Assignment Help JAVA Programming
Reference no: EM13899619

You will learn how to create menu-based programs using GUIs.

Please respond to all of the following prompts with 1-2 paragraphs of original content:

Discuss GUI components, explain how to handle key and mouse events, and state how they relate to GUI programming in Java.

What are the advantages of using an applet over a GUI?

When would a GUI be preferable?

Choose one GUI component and elaborate on the circumstances of how and why it would be the most appropriate choice in your work environment.

 

Reference no: EM13899619

Questions Cloud

.golden corp. a merchandiser recently completed : 1.Golden Corp., a merchandiser, recently completed its 2013 operations.
Information reported about golden corporation : 1.Refer to the information reported about Golden Corporation in Problem 16- 4A. In Problem 16- 4A, Golden Corp.
Prompt the user for the tax amount : Write detailed pseudo code for a program that is designed to organize a family's tax payments for the past 20 years. The program should accomplish the following tasks: Prompt the user for the tax amount and also the year.
Brilliantly pragmatic statesmanship : While Ashoka's dhamma policy was avowedly peaceful and paternalistic, it gave India decades of peace in which the country prospered. It was not a vaguely idealistic policy but one which was backed by brilliantly pragmatic statesmanship and public ..
Create menu-based programs using guis : You will learn how to create menu-based programs using GUIs. Please respond to all of the following prompts with 1-2 paragraphs of original content: Discuss GUI components, explain how to handle key and mouse events, and state how they relate to GU..
Demanding lifestyle commitment to moral life : Hindus practice a very demanding lifestyle commitment to Moral life. One of the major concepts is called "ahimsa" or non-injury to all living things. Do you believe this is a higher Demand that the Judeo-Christian Christian command: "Do not kill?"..
What security measures may be used by retailers to protect : What security measures may be used by retailers to protect merchandise inventory from customer theft? Which inventory system (perpetual or periodic) provides the more effective means of controlling inventories? Why?
Development of effective marketing mix strategy : Development of an effective and efficient marketing mix strategy - You must develop and overall insight regarding the consumer, making the focus of the report on "proving" your insight to a marketing manager.
Question regarding the tradition of bhakti : Compare and contrast the Vedic tradition with the tradition of bhakti. Describe in detail the worldview of each, particularly in relation to the sacrifice, the relationship of the gods/goddesses to human beings and the religious goals that one tri..

Reviews

Write a Review

JAVA Programming Questions & Answers

  Create a java class called month

Create a program/project called [YourName]-(replace [YourName] with your actual name) in the same project as the Month.java, Create three objects: Month1 one using the first constructor (with no arguments) and Month2 using the second constructor wi..

  Develop game using the concepts of cohesion

Develop any game of your choice using the concepts of Cohesion, Coupling and RDD, i.e., responsibility-driven design.

  Your letterinventory class must use an array

Your LetterInventory class must use an array of Counter objects. Note that there is no nextChar method in the Scanner class. You must use the next() method and then use a loop through the characters of the token that is returned. Ignore any character..

  Design a program that does some polynomial operations

Implement polynomial addition by using an add() method, so you could write in program - Build a polynomial (linked list) from a file and the other from keyboard input (pairs of coefficients and powers) by a user.

  Uses a 2-d array to store the highest and lowest temperature

Write a program that uses a 2-D array to store the highest and lowest temperatures for each montjh of the year. The program should output the average high, average low, and highest and lowest temperatures of the year. Your program must consist of ..

  1 introductionin order to debug an application it is

1 introductionin order to debug an application it is sometimes useful to know where a given object comes from or where

  Method named isallvowels that returns

Write a method named isAllVowels that returns whether a String consists entirely of vowels (a, e, i, o, or u, case-insensitively). If every character of the String is a vowel, your method should return true. If any character of the String is a non-vo..

  Solve the currently very un-pc cigarette smokers problem

Write solution to solve the currently very un-PC"cigarette smokers problem" in java using Java threads, and monitors (using the "synchronized" keyword) (If it bothers your PC sensibilities, think of it at the Pot-smokers problem and then it is all pr..

  Write a bluej project- birthday paradox

The birthday paradox states that if there are 23 people in a room then there is a slightly more than 50:50 chance that at least two of them will have the same birthday.

  Design 3 shoppingbay is an online auction service that

3. shoppingbay is an online auction service that requires several reports. design a flowchart or psuedocode this is

  Write a program that establishes two savings accounts

Write a program that establishes two savings accounts with saver1 having account number 10002 with an initial balance of $2,000, and saver2 having account 10003 with an initial balance of $3,000

  Determine java application on web and structure functions

Determine the Java application on Web and explain how program structure functions. Explain the application in as much detail as possible.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d